Бесплатный урок с нашим репетитором!

Узнать подробнее

Новая Школа - онлайн-школа подготовки к ЕГЭ
При поддержке
Посмотреть все вопросы нейросети
Бесплатный пробный урок с репетитором

Узнай больше про репетиторов Новой Школы и запишись на бесплатный пробный урок. Мы проверим твой уровень знаний и составим план обучения по любому предмету и классу

Вопрос от Анонимного юзера 20 мая 2025 20:15

Написать

Ответ нейросети

20 мая 2025 20:15

Давайте решим задачу поэтапно.

Задача:
Написать программу в Pascal, которая, исходя из начального радиуса окружности (5 см) и площади 15 окружностей, определяет площадь каждой следующей окружности, при условии, что радиус каждой следующей окружности увеличивается на некоторое число.


Разбор задачи и шаги решения:

  1. Известные данные:

    • Начальный радиус ( r_1 = 5 ) см
    • Общее количество окружностей ( n = 15 )
    • Радиус каждой следующей окружности меняется на некоторое число ( d ) (нужно определить)
  2. Что нужно найти:

    • Радиусы всех окружностей
    • Площадь каждой окружности
  3. Площадь окружности: [ S = \pi r^2 ]

    Для радиуса 5 см: [ S_1 = \pi \times 5^2 = 25\pi ]

  4. Параметр изменения радиусов: Пусть радиус каждой следующей окружности увеличивается на постоянное число ( d ). Тогда радиусы: [ r_k = r_1 + (k - 1) \times d, \quad \text{k=1,2,...,15} ]

  5. Общая площадь всех окружностей: [ \sum_{k=1}^{15} \pi r_k^2 ]

    Или, если нужно найти площадь определённой окружности, например, 1-го: [ S_1 = 25\pi ] Второй: [ S_2 = \pi (r_1 + d)^2 ] И так далее.


Пример программы на Pascal:

program Circles;
uses Math;
const
  n = 15; // Количество окружностей
  r_start = 5; // Начальный радиус
  total_area = 15; // Предполагаемая общая площадь, если нужно
var
  i: integer;
  d: Real; // Изменение радиуса
  r: array[1..n] of Real;
  sum_area: Real;
begin
  // Расчет d так, чтобы сумма площадей равнялась определенной (например, 15 окружностей, радиус aumentaется)
  // Можно задать d или вычислить его. Для простоты предположим d = 1 см
  d := 1;

  // Вычисляем радиусы
  for i := 1 to n do
  begin
    r[i] := r_start + (i - 1) * d;
  end;

  // Выводим радиусы и площади
  sum_area := 0;
  for i := 1 to n do
  begin
    writeln('Радиус окружности ', i, ': ', r[i]:0:2, ' см');
    writeln('Площадь окружности ', i, ': ', Pi * r[i] * r[i]:0:2, ' кв. см');
    sum_area := sum_area + Pi * r[i] * r[i];
  end;

  writeln('Общая площадь всех окружностей: ', sum_area:0:2);
end.

Объяснение:

  • В программе задается начальный радиус ( r_1 = 5 ),
  • Уменьшение или увеличение радиусов осуществляется с шагом ( d ),
  • Для каждой окружности вычисляется радиус и площадь,
  • Итоговая сумма площадей показывает, насколько равномерно увеличиваются размеры.

Если нужно определить конкретное значение ( d ) исходя из общей площади или других условий, можно задать соответствующую задачу.


Если вам нужно более конкретное условие или расчет — уточняйте!

Задай свой вопрос

Напиши любую задачу или вопрос, а нейросеть её решит

Похожие вопросы 15

Бесплатно Мобильное приложение ГДЗ
Мобильное приложение ГДЗ

Задавай вопросы искуcственному интеллекту текстом или фотографиями в приложении на iPhone или Android

qr-codegoogle-playapp-store

Саша — ассистент в телеграмме

написать
Давайте решим задачу поэтапно. **Задача:** Написать программу в Pascal, которая, исходя из начального радиуса окружности (5 см) и площади 15 окружностей, определяет площадь каждой следующей окружности, при условии, что радиус каждой следующей окружности увеличивается на некоторое число. --- ### Разбор задачи и шаги решения: 1. **Известные данные:** - Начальный радиус \( r_1 = 5 \) см - Общее количество окружностей \( n = 15 \) - Радиус каждой следующей окружности меняется на некоторое число \( d \) (нужно определить) 2. **Что нужно найти:** - Радиусы всех окружностей - Площадь каждой окружности 3. **Площадь окружности:** \[ S = \pi r^2 \] Для радиуса 5 см: \[ S_1 = \pi \times 5^2 = 25\pi \] 4. **Параметр изменения радиусов:** Пусть радиус каждой следующей окружности увеличивается на постоянное число \( d \). Тогда радиусы: \[ r_k = r_1 + (k - 1) \times d, \quad \text{k=1,2,...,15} \] 5. **Общая площадь всех окружностей:** \[ \sum_{k=1}^{15} \pi r_k^2 \] Или, если нужно найти площадь определённой окружности, например, 1-го: \[ S_1 = 25\pi \] Второй: \[ S_2 = \pi (r_1 + d)^2 \] И так далее. --- ### Пример программы на Pascal: ```pascal program Circles; uses Math; const n = 15; // Количество окружностей r_start = 5; // Начальный радиус total_area = 15; // Предполагаемая общая площадь, если нужно var i: integer; d: Real; // Изменение радиуса r: array[1..n] of Real; sum_area: Real; begin // Расчет d так, чтобы сумма площадей равнялась определенной (например, 15 окружностей, радиус aumentaется) // Можно задать d или вычислить его. Для простоты предположим d = 1 см d := 1; // Вычисляем радиусы for i := 1 to n do begin r[i] := r_start + (i - 1) * d; end; // Выводим радиусы и площади sum_area := 0; for i := 1 to n do begin writeln('Радиус окружности ', i, ': ', r[i]:0:2, ' см'); writeln('Площадь окружности ', i, ': ', Pi * r[i] * r[i]:0:2, ' кв. см'); sum_area := sum_area + Pi * r[i] * r[i]; end; writeln('Общая площадь всех окружностей: ', sum_area:0:2); end. ``` --- ### Объяснение: - В программе задается начальный радиус \( r_1 = 5 \), - Уменьшение или увеличение радиусов осуществляется с шагом \( d \), - Для каждой окружности вычисляется радиус и площадь, - Итоговая сумма площадей показывает, насколько равномерно увеличиваются размеры. Если нужно определить конкретное значение \( d \) исходя из общей площади или других условий, можно задать соответствующую задачу. --- Если вам нужно более конкретное условие или расчет — уточняйте!